Magnus Lie Hetland submitted the

                    abspos

package.

Version:  0.1 2022-09-22
License:  mit

Summary description:  Absolute placement with coffins

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
 
 The abspos package lets you place contents at an absolute position,
 anchored at some specified part of the contents, similar to how TikZ
 nodes work, though without using the two-pass strategy of TikZ.
 It also avoids messing with the order of beamer overlays, which
 is what happens when one uses the textpos package with the
 overlay option.
 The solution used is quite straightforward, combining coffins
 (using l3coffins) with the placement mechanisms of atbegshi.
